Commentary Organization:

Introduction: This section provides an overview of the entire book, covering various aspects such as context, date, authorship, composition, interpretive issues, purpose, and theology. It serves as a foundational guide to understanding the commentary's content.

Pericope Bibliography: This section includes a comprehensive list of the most important works related to each particular pericope. It serves as a valuable resource for further exploration and study.

Translation: The author presents their own translation of the biblical text, carefully crafted to reflect the outcome of exegesis while also paying attention to Hebrew and Greek idiomatic usage of words, phrases, and tenses. The translation aims to provide a readable and accessible version in English.

Notes: The author's notes to the translation offer additional insights and explanations. They address textual variants, grammatical forms, syntactical constructions, basic meanings of words, and translation problems. These notes provide valuable context and aid in understanding the text.

Form/Structure/Setting: This section delves into the redaction, genre, sources, and tradition associated with the pericope. It explores the origin of the passage, its canonical form, and its relationship to biblical and extra-biblical contexts. It also introduces important rhetorical contexts that contribute to the structure and character of the pericope. Rhetorical or compositional features that are crucial for understanding the passage are also highlighted in this section.

Comment: The commentary provides a verse-by-verse analysis, offering detailed explanations and interpretations of the text. It explores the literary, historical, cultural, and theological dimensions of the passage, providing insights into its meaning and significance within the broader context of biblical theology.
